En la imagen se muestra la configuración básica de los recursos empleados al utilizar Oracle Visual Builder Studio para desarrollar una aplicación web.
El diagrama consta de una recopilación de recursos comunes y compartidos y una matriz de servicios de red de Oracle Service. Los recursos comunes y compartidos se dividen en cinco grupos: gestión de proyectos, Visual Builder Studio, desarrollo, integración/control de calidad y producción.
- La gestión de proyectos contiene tareas y un proceso de Agile.
- Visual Builder Studio es donde se producen la codificación, el control de versiones, las compilaciones y la gestión de versiones, y contiene:
- Un proceso de revisión de código
- Un repositorio de Git
- Tres instancias de Visual Builder Cloud Service combinadas con un pipeline de integración y despliegue continuos
El desarrollo, la integración y el control de calidad y la producción contienen una máquina virtual sin estado y una instancia sin servidor, cuyo tipo depende del proceso:
- El desarrollo aloja eventos sin servidor
- Contenedores sin servidor de hosts de integración/control de calidad
- Funciones sin servidor de hosts de producción
El tráfico se dirige desde la revisión de código de VB Studio al repositorio de Git, donde se puede distribuir a una de las instancias de pipeline de VBCS/CI/CD. Una de estas instancias dirigirá el tráfico al proceso de desarrollo, una al proceso de integración/control de calidad y otra al proceso de producción.